TURN-208: Gatevale turnstile counters at the Merrow Field pilot double-count when a rotation reverses mid-cycle. Attendance totals drift roughly 2% high per event. The debounce window fix is implemented, reviewed by Ilsa, and soak-tested across two simulated match days without drift. Ready for your cut; the candidate build is identified below.

trace token, tagag-tafog: htk6_5ed18c

TICKET-4482: Digest scheduler vault locked. The Quillhook batch email digest cron config lives in the Marrowgate vault; it auto-locked after three failed unseal attempts during the 06:00 schedule rollover. Digests are paused until unsealed. Do not edit the cron spec by hand — the scheduler reconciles from vault state only. Unseal via the ops console, then re-enable the hourly batch job. The passphrase to unseal is below.

unlock words, bajop-hafog: tamdor-kelix-pelys-eliys-gormir-wenys-novath-holiel-belael-quenion-istax-quenius-eliir

Subject: TilePath prefetcher — ready for cut

Rena,

Prefetcher changes for TilePath are merged. Radius heuristic now caps at zoom 14, so mobile data usage drops ~30% in our Harwick-route tests. No schema changes, no migration. QA signed off yesterday; perf dashboard is green. One known nit: prefetch queue logs are noisy at debug level — fix queued for next sprint, not a blocker.

Please include in tonight's release train. The candidate build is identified below.

trace token, fafog-kageg: htk4_98e6